Pumped Media Seals

The optimum primary seal can be chosen to match the pumped media and duty conditions. Single or double mechanical seals include flushed or aseptic variants. For arduous duties hard faced seal materials such as tungsten carbide or silicon carbide can be used. A wide variety of commercially available mechanical seal options including single and double cartridge seals are available for sludge and other difficult applications. Packed glands offer a simple, low cost, and easy to maintain controlled leakage sealing arrangement. Pumped media wetted elastomers are EPDM, NBR, FPM all FDA conforming or PTFE for chemical applications.

 
 
Connections
Pump casings are supplied with integral cast flanged inlet and outlet connections to all major standards including ASA/ANSI150, BS4504/DIN2533, BS10E and more.  
 
Rotor Materials
For increased abrasion resistance pumps may be supplied with NBR covered (models A7-0550-H07 & A8-0745-H10).  
 
Surface Finish & Coatings
For abrasive applications the pumphead and rotors may be supplied with a tungsten carbide coating or other surface hardening treatment to increase wear resistance.  
 
Increased Pressure Rating

Alternative higher strength shaft materials will enhance pressure ratings.

  • 145 psi for pump model A7-0550-H07
  • 100 psi for pump model A8-1149-H03
 
 
Motorized Pump Units
Series A pumps may be supplied fully motorized with fixed or variable speed drives including appropriate control systems if required, mounted on either mild steel or stainless steel baseplates. In addition to electric motor drives, hydraulic, pneumatic, diesel or gasoline powered prime movers can be fitted.
